Claude simon is a representative writer of the French New Fiction School, known as the "father of the new novel", his masterpiece and famous work "Flanders Expressway".

Claude simon's novels include Liar, Wire Rope and Wind and Grass. Among these novels, The Wind, Grass and other works adopt unique sentence rhythm and limited narrative perspective, which indicates that Simon's writing style has been formed. In 1960s, Simon's creation entered the second stage. During this period, he joined the new novel camp Midnight Publishing House, and gathered a group of experimental writers such as sallot, Bhutto, Rob Geyer and Bangor.
